Join me as together we will be recreating at least one scene from Obsession. Perhaps more if time allows.
Obsession had excellent use of shadows and I will do my best to recreate some of the shots. I will explain my working theory, the processes I use to get that high contrast image to get deep shadows, and how to backlight and balance the lighting so you can have a usable image for post processing. This will be a collaborative exercise where I will be the guide.

Alex DePew has spent 17 years in the film industry as a Cinematographer and Gaffer, working on projects ranging from no-budget shorts, music videos, art projects, to ad campaigns for brands like Volkswagen, Loro Piana, and Adidas. He got his start in New York City, his hometown, and has shot all over the world. After moving to Berlin he found his passion for teaching and has taught hundreds of students over the past 9 years. Alex guides you through lighting craft with clarity and enthusiasm, making complex concepts accessible to all.
